Congratulations to Emmanuel Macron on his election as President of France
The Founder of Peace and National Unity – Leader of the Nation, President of the Republic of Tajikistan, His Excellency Emomali Rahmon extended congratulations to French president-elect Emmanuel Macron.
The President’s message reads, in particular:
«Your Excellency,
It gives me great pleasure to extend to You my sincere congratulations on the occasion of your convincing victory at the elections of the President of the French Republic.
Tajikistan highly appreciates current level and content of its partnership relations with France and considers the complex of effective cooperation with it an important direction of its foreign policy.
We look with optimism at the prospects of relationships with the French Republic and we hope that during your leadership friendly relations and multifaceted cooperation between our countries in various directions of mutual interest will enter a new stage of their development.
Expressing my readiness for mutual aspirations in this direction, I wish Your Excellency good health, new successes, and to the friendly people of France — lasting peace and further prosperity».
